mirmahdijafari

کرون برای acymailing

21 پست در این موضوع

سلام

از دوستان کسی میتونه برای فعال کردن کرون برای acymailing (هاست من cpanel هست) آموزشی قرار بده یا دسترسی بدم برای اینکه توی هاست و جوملا فعالش کنه ؟

برای دوره آموزش از طریق ایمیل بهش نیاز دارم و خیلی ضروریه-میخوام ایمیل ها به محض ثبت نام بصورت زمان بندی شده ارسال بشه-الان وقتی ایمیل رو وارد میکنم میره توی صف انتظار میمونه و ارسال نمیشه

ممنون از دوستانی که همیشه راهنمای من بودند.

Share this post


Link to post
Share on other sites
آموزش ووکامرس قالب جوملا قالب وردپرس قالب رایگان وردپرس قالب رایگان جوملا هاست نامحدود هاست جوملا هاست لاراول هاست وردپرس هاست ارزان هاست ربات تلگرام خرید دامنه آموزش ساخت ربات تلگرام با php آموزش لاراول آموزش cPanel آموزش php آموزش فرم ساز RSform آموزش ساخت ربات جذب ممبر آموزش ساخت ربات دوستیابی آموزش ساخت ربات فروشگاهی برای ووکامرس آموزش طراحی سایت داینامیک با php آموزش بخش پشتیبانی با rsticket
سلام

از دوستان کسی میتونه برای فعال کردن کرون برای acymailing (هاست من cpanel هست) آموزشی قرار بده یا دسترسی بدم برای اینکه توی هاست و جوملا فعالش کنه ؟

برای دوره آموزش از طریق ایمیل بهش نیاز دارم و خیلی ضروریه-میخوام ایمیل ها به محض ثبت نام بصورت زمان بندی شده ارسال بشه-الان وقتی ایمیل رو وارد میکنم میره توی صف انتظار میمونه و ارسال نمیشه

ممنون از دوستانی که همیشه راهنمای من بودند.

به این لینک مراجعه کنید

Share this post


Link to post
Share on other sites

دوست عزیز ممنون از پاسخ سریعتون

به این لینک قبلا هم رفته بودم اما متوجه نشدم

میتونید یه توضیح فارسی بدید؟

ممنون میشم

Share this post


Link to post
Share on other sites
دوست عزیز ممنون از پاسخ سریعتون

به این لینک قبلا هم رفته بودم اما متوجه نشدم

میتونید یه توضیح فارسی بدید؟

ممنون میشم

می تونید از این روش دستی این امکان رو فعال کنید :

1- توی کرون جاب سی پنل دستور زیر رو بنویسید :

php -f /home/YOUR_USERNAME/public_html/acymail.php

(بجای YOUR_USERNAME، یوزرنیم سایت خودتون رو بزارید. )

2- و یه فایل پی اچ پی به نام acymail.php توی روت اصلی سایت بسازید و داخلش کد زیر رو بذارید:

<?php
$ch = curl_init();
curl_setopt($ch, CURLOPT_URL,'http://www.yoursite.com/index.php?option=com_acymailing&ctrl=cron');
curl_setopt($ch, CURLOPT_RETURNTRANSFER,1);
curl_setopt($ch, CURLOPT_TIMEOUT, 15);
@curl_setopt($ch, CURLOPT_FOLLOWLOCATION,true);
curl_setopt($ch, CURLOPT_AUTOREFERER,true);
echo curl_exec($ch);
curl_close($ch);

(بجای yoursite آدرس دامنه سایت خودتون رو جایگزین کنید.)

همچنین عدد 15 میزان وقفه ارسال ایمیل ها هستش که باید با میزان موجود در تنظیمات جوملا برابر باشد

Share this post


Link to post
Share on other sites
می تونید از این روش دستی این امکان رو فعال کنید :

1- توی کرون جاب سی پنل دستور زیر رو بنویسید :

php -f /home/YOUR_USERNAME/public_html/acymail.php

(بجای YOUR_USERNAME، یوزرنیم سایت خودتون رو بزارید. )

2- و یه فایل پی اچ پی به نام acymail.php توی روت اصلی سایت بسازید و داخلش کد زیر رو بذارید:

<?php
$ch = curl_init();
curl_setopt($ch, CURLOPT_URL,'http://www.yoursite.com/index.php?option=com_acymailing&ctrl=cron');
curl_setopt($ch, CURLOPT_RETURNTRANSFER,1);
curl_setopt($ch, CURLOPT_TIMEOUT, 15);
@curl_setopt($ch, CURLOPT_FOLLOWLOCATION,true);
curl_setopt($ch, CURLOPT_AUTOREFERER,true);
echo curl_exec($ch);
curl_close($ch);

(بجای yoursite آدرس دامنه سایت خودتون رو جایگزین کنید.)

همچنین عدد 15 میزان وقفه ارسال ایمیل ها هستش که باید با میزان موجود در تنظیمات جوملا برابر باشد

با سلام واحترام

آقای پویانویدمیشه بگین ادرس کرون جاب سی پنل منظورتون کجاست؟؟؟؟؟دقیقا کدوم فایل؟؟؟؟

من ب صورت خودکار فعالش کردم ولی تو هاست فایلی اضافه نشده ک برم کدی ک گفتین و وارد کنم؟؟؟؟

ممنون

Share this post


Link to post
Share on other sites
با سلام واحترام

آقای پویانویدمیشه بگین ادرس کرون جاب سی پنل منظورتون کجاست؟؟؟؟؟دقیقا کدوم فایل؟؟؟؟

من ب صورت خودکار فعالش کردم ولی تو هاست فایلی اضافه نشده ک برم کدی ک گفتین و وارد کنم؟؟؟؟

ممنون

آموزش فعال سازی کرون جابز Cron Jobs در سی پنل CPanel

ابتدا وارد کنترل پنل cpanel بشید

سپس روی گزینه Cron jobs کلیک کنید

[ATTACH=CONFIG]6710[/ATTACH]

در صفحه باز شده

[ATTACH=CONFIG]6709[/ATTACH]

قسمت دقیقه رو * میزاریم. (باید علامت * باشه)

قسمت ساعت رو میزاریم روی 10 (به معنای ساعت 10 صبح)

قسمت روز رو * میزاریم. (یعنی هر روز...)

قسمت ماه رو هم * میزاریم. (یعنی هر ماه...)

قسمت روز هفته رو هم * می زاریم . (یعنی هر روز هفته)

پس شد هر روز صبح ساعت 10.00دقیقه بیا فایل مورد نظر رو بررسی کن.

خب مسیر فایل رو هم در قسمت command می زاریم

به طور مثال فایل ps.php موجود در پوشه public_html به صورت زیر هست :

کد:

php /home/username/public_html/ps.php

منظور از username نام کاربری شما در cpanel می باشد.

حالا فقط باید چیزای پست قبلی رو جایگزین اینا کنی

منبع: پرشین اسکریپت

Share this post


Link to post
Share on other sites

با سلام

از اموزشون واقعا ممنونم ولی تو سی پنلی ک من در اختیار دارم چنین گزینه ای وجود نداره اینم از عکسی ک از سی پنل گرفتم

[ATTACH=CONFIG]6713[/ATTACH]

Share this post


Link to post
Share on other sites
با سلام

از اموزشون واقعا ممنونم ولی تو سی پنلی ک من در اختیار دارم چنین گزینه ای وجود نداره اینم از عکسی ک از سی پنل گرفتم

[ATTACH=CONFIG]6713[/ATTACH]

عکس برای file manager هست

باید بری تو قسمت main سی پنل مث عکس زیر

[ATTACH=CONFIG]6714[/ATTACH]

بدشم بری تو cron jobs

[ATTACH=CONFIG]6715[/ATTACH]

Share this post


Link to post
Share on other sites

ارسال شده در (ویرایش شده)

با سلام و احترام

ممنون از آموزشتون آقای پویانوید

فعال کردم ولی ی مشکلی ک وجود داره اینه ارسالات خودکاری ک تعریف کردم برای کاربر فرستاده شه در صف انتظار 4 ساعت عقبتر نشون میده مثلا الان ساعت 11 اگه کاربری ثبت نام کنه پیغامی ک قرار ه براش ارسال شه ساعت 7 ثبت شده

تاریخ و چجوری تنظیم کنم ک درست ثبت بشه

باز ممنون

ویرایش شده در توسط r.zahra

Share this post


Link to post
Share on other sites
با سلام و احترام

ممنون از آموزشتون آقای پویانوید

فعال کردم ولی ی مشکلی ک وجود داره اینه ارسالات خودکاری ک تعریف کردم برای کاربر فرستاده شه در صف انتظار 4 ساعت عقبتر نشون میده مثلا الان ساعت 11 اگه کاربری ثبت نام کنه پیغامی ک قرار ه براش ارسال شه ساعت 7 ثبت شده

تاریخ و چجوری تنظیم کنم ک درست ثبت بشه

باز ممنون

فکر کنم مشکل از ساعت سرورتون باشه

باید برید تو اکانت SSH تون

با استفاده از دستور زیر می تونید این کار رو انجام دهید:

date -s "7 OCT 2011 18:00:00"

و یا

date --set="7 OCT 2011 18:00:00"

فکر کنم بعدش درست بشه

Share this post


Link to post
Share on other sites

ارسال شده در (ویرایش شده)

فکر کنم مشکل از ساعت سرورتون باشه

باید برید تو اکانت SSH تون

با استفاده از دستور زیر می تونید این کار رو انجام دهید:

date -s "7 OCT 2011 18:00:00"

و یا

date --set="7 OCT 2011 18:00:00"

فکر کنم بعدش درست بشه

سلام

چجوری به اکانت ssh سرورم دسترسی داشته باشم؟؟؟

یعنی کدوم قسمت من اون دستورهای گفته شده رو بنویسم

[ATTACH=CONFIG]6732[/ATTACH]

ویرایش شده در توسط r.zahra

Share this post


Link to post
Share on other sites

سلام

ایشون فکر کنم هاست اشتراکی دارند و دسترسی به ssh ندارد. از تنظیمات جوملا نگاه کنید ببنید ساعت سیستم درست تنظیم شده یا نه

Share this post


Link to post
Share on other sites

سلام آقای نوید ممنون از اینکه وقت میذارین

من مراحل گفته شده در SSh رو انجام دادم همش این خطا رو میده

[ATTACH=CONFIG]6733[/ATTACH]

دومین سوال:زمانی ک لاگین و وارد کنیم منظورش کدوم لاگین؟؟؟همون یوزر و پسوردی ک وارد سی پنل میشیم؟؟؟

من اونا رو وارد کردم ولی خطای بالا رو میده چکار کنم؟؟؟

Share this post


Link to post
Share on other sites
سلام

ایشون فکر کنم هاست اشتراکی دارند و دسترسی به ssh ندارد. از تنظیمات جوملا نگاه کنید ببنید ساعت سیستم درست تنظیم شده یا نه

سلام آقای فتحی

تو تنظیمات جوملا تاریخ سرور رو گزینه "زمان جهانی (utc)" تنظیم شده درسته؟؟؟ ایران وجود نداره

Share this post


Link to post
Share on other sites

مشکل از تنظیمات cron job هست درست ست نشده در تصویر مشخص هست که اشتباه ست شده. فکر کنم یک لینک راهنما در یک پستی دیروز زدم برای تنظیمات کرون جاب ان را مطالعه بفرمایید

Share this post


Link to post
Share on other sites
سلام آقای نوید ممنون از اینکه وقت میذارین

من مراحل گفته شده در SSh رو انجام دادم همش این خطا رو میده

[ATTACH=CONFIG]6733[/ATTACH]

دومین سوال:زمانی ک لاگین و وارد کنیم منظورش کدوم لاگین؟؟؟همون یوزر و پسوردی ک وارد سی پنل میشیم؟؟؟

من اونا رو وارد کردم ولی خطای بالا رو میده چکار کنم؟؟؟

خواهش میکنم

1.من نتونستم فایل پیوست رو ببینم،ارور میده!

شما از هاست اشتراکی استفاده میکنی؟

2.بله همون یوزر و پس cpanel رو باید بزنی

فایل پیوست رو نتونستم ببینم.ارور میده!

Share this post


Link to post
Share on other sites
سلام

فک کنم بله

[ATTACH=CONFIG]6734[/ATTACH]

این ارور میگه که دسترسی به shell تو اکانت شما فعال نیست،اگه نیاز به دسترسی به shell داری باید با هاستنگت صحبت کنی

shell access is not enabled on your account

if you need shell access please contact support

1 کاربر پسند دیده است

Share this post


Link to post
Share on other sites
این ارور میگه که دسترسی به shell تو اکانت شما فعال نیست،اگه نیاز به دسترسی به shell داری باید با هاستنگت صحبت کنی

shell access is not enabled on your account

if you need shell access please contact support

با سلام و سپاس

حل شد مشکل از نسخه افزونه بود ک هی من فعال میکردم چن روز بعد خودکار غیر فعال میشد

تنظیمات تاریخ هم از خود جوملاست

باز اقای نوید از اینکه ب سوالاتم وقت میذاشتین و پاسخ میدادین ممنونم:thanks:

Share this post


Link to post
Share on other sites
با سلام و سپاس

حل شد مشکل از نسخه افزونه بود ک هی من فعال میکردم چن روز بعد خودکار غیر فعال میشد

تنظیمات تاریخ هم از خود جوملاست

باز اقای نوید از اینکه ب سوالاتم وقت میذاشتین و پاسخ میدادین ممنونم:thanks:

خواهش

ولی اصن فکر نمیکردم که از نسخه افزونه باشه

خوش حالم ازین که مشکلت حل شده

Share this post


Link to post
Share on other sites

برای ارسال نظر یک حساب کاربری ایجاد کنید یا وارد حساب خود شوید

برای اینکه بتوانید نظر ارسال کنید نیاز دارید که کاربر سایت شوید

ایجاد یک حساب کاربری

برای حساب کاربری جدید در انجمن ما ثبت نام کنید. عضویت خیلی ساده است !


ثبت نام یک حساب کاربری جدید

ورود به حساب کاربری

دارای حساب کاربری هستید؟ از اینجا وارد شوید


ورود به حساب کاربری